Director of Computer Forensics & Cybersecurity

Digital Mountain is a dynamic, Silicon Valley-based company in the high growth and fast changing area of computer forensics, cybersecurity and electronic discovery. We are seeking a Director of Computer Forensics & Cybersecurity to be part of our energetic, fun, collaborative and hard-working team. The company is privately held and has customers among the largest law firms, corporations and government organizations in the United States. Most travel is local.

Requirements

Technical Skills
  • Ability to edit and provide technical input on forensic reports
  • Strong technical experience working with desktops, laptops, servers and enterprise-level systems
  • An understanding of various Windows-based file systems
  • Background working with smartphones
  • Background working with different levels of RAID (0, 1 & 5)
  • Proficient in the use of EnCase, FTK, Axiom, Blacklight and other mainstream forensic tools
  • An understanding of proper data collection techniques and documentation
  • Must have the ability to learn new tools and technologies
  • Flexibility to work on electronic discovery matters when needed
  • Mac forensics experience is a plus
  • Linux and Unix experience is a plus
  • Solid working knowledge of Office 365 and electronic discovery workflow is a plus
  • Security log analysis and cyber experience is a plus

Manager of Software Engineering

Digital Mountain, an entrepreneurial Silicon Valley-based SaaS company, is seeking a Manager of Software Engineering to lead our software engineering group for Version 3.0 and beyond. We are a leading provider of electronic discovery providing software and services on a national basis. The company is privately held and has customers among the largest law firms and corporations in the United States. We’re a highly dynamic environment and you will own the architecture, the management of the group, and be responsible for a significant percentage of the coding as well.


Experience and Education
  • 8-12 years of experience in Java, database and web development in a Unix/Linux environment.
  • Experience managing complete SDLC, including implementing appropriate processes for agile development and planning long-term projects.
  • Have worked on (and preferably designed) information retrieval or document management systems.
  • Experience working with SaaS-based applications.
  • BS/MS degree in computer science, engineering or equivalent experience.
  • Previous experience at a successful, entrepreneurial startup and a larger company a must.

Technical Skills
  • 8+ years of Java and SQL development experience, as well as C/C++.
  • Experience with building fault-tolerant, scalable, collaboration-driven database back-end web applications.
  • Must have experience with Spring and Hibernate; knowledge of Tapestry a strong plus.
  • Development & administration experience in web servers (Apache), application servers (Tomcat, JBoss), and databases (Oracle & PostgreSQL).
  • Experience with clustered database environments and grid computing a plus.
  • Experience with BIRT reporting tools a plus.
  • Experience with SVN and GIT.
  • Ability to evaluate in-bound technologies for licensing from a technical standpoint.
  • Previous experience building or working with a team managing a data center also a strong plus.
